Mostrar

Olvidaste tu contraseña?

Olvidaste tu contraseña? Por favor inserta tu correo y recibiras un link para crear una nueva contraseña.

Error message here!

In a entrar de nuevo

Olvidaste tu contraseña?

Registrate rápido con face, twitte, google, github
o usa tu correo electronico

Registrate!!

Close

Mysql ayuda imprecion Distinct

0 votes
asked Jan 1, 2020 in Bases de datos by play (14 points)

una pregunta rapido> como puedo hacer que el mysql me imprima un id sin repetirse ejemplo

1./ andres /foto1
2./ maria /foto2
3./ juan /foto3
1./ andres/ foto4

quiero presentar solo una vez por id en la pagina. pero si lo hago de esta forma

  <?php $b = mysql_query("SELECT DISTINCT id_poster from posts");while($br=mysql_fetch_array($b)){  ?>

no me funciona porque no me aparece la columna de la imagen.

ahora si lo hago de esta manera no funciona la funcion que quiero realizar que es de que no se dupliquen los id en pantalla.

  <?php $b = mysql_query("SELECT DISTINCT id_poster,imagen from posts");while($br=mysql_fetch_array($b)){   ?>

ayudaaaaaaaaaa pliz

1 Answer

0 votes
answered Jan 21, 2020 by joseiriarte1982 (125 points)

Una disculpa por llegar tarde a la fiesta, pero como sea para que quede como presedente, solo te falta especificar cual va a ser el campo que quieres distinto y eso lo haces agrupando los resultados, es este caso SELECT DISTINCT idposter,imagen from posts GROUP BY idposter

GROUP BY hace la magia, saludos amigo

...